libpurple
libpurple(3) C Library Functions libpurple(3)
NAME
libpurple - core IM library
DESCRIPTION
libpurple is a core library to be used by IM programs. It is used by pidgin(1).
libpurple library could connect to the IM networks, manage accounts and preferences, and other helpful things. When using libpurple, you
will basically be writing a UI for this core code. pidgin is a GTK+ frontend to libpurple.
FILES
The following files are used:
/usr/lib/libpurple.so Core IM library of Pidgin
